DefaultConnectingIOReactor throws ConcurrentModificationException in
processEvents() method
-------------------------------------------------------------------------------------------
Key: HTTPCORE-164
URL: https://issues.apache.org/jira/browse/HTTPCORE-164
Project: HttpComponents HttpCore
Issue Type: Bug
Components: HttpCore NIO
Affects Versions: 4.0-beta2
Environment: Win XP
JDK 1.6.0-b105
httpcore-nio-beta2-20080510.140437-10.jar
httpcore-beta2-20080510.140437-10.jar
Reporter: Denis Rogov
Priority: Critical
Using httpcomponents nio to serve as http client.
Occasionally getting exception that stops reactor and therefore all engine work:
Exception in thread "IO Reactor Execution Thread"
java.util.ConcurrentModificationException
at java.util.HashMap$HashIterator.nextEntry(HashMap.java:793)
at java.util.HashMap$KeyIterator.next(HashMap.java:827)
at
org.apache.http.impl.nio.reactor.DefaultConnectingIOReactor.processEvents(DefaultConnectingIOReactor.java:93)
at
org.apache.http.impl.nio.reactor.AbstractMultiworkerIOReactor.execute(AbstractMultiworkerIOReactor.java:162)
at
<...>HttpManagerApacheAsyncEngineImpl$1.run(HttpManagerApacheAsyncEngineImpl.java:294)
at java.lang.Thread.run(Thread.java:619)
--
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]